The Council has one main Planning Committee and two
sub-committees - Planning Sub-Committee A and Planning
Sub-Committee B. The Planning Sub-Committees
consider planning applications that have not been determined by the
Service Director Planning and Development, under delegated
authority, and which are not classified as major applications, as
defined in the Town and Country Planning (General Development)
Procedure Order 1995 (as amended). Full details are in Part 5 of
the Council's
Constitution.
Residents can make representations about any of the
planning applications on a meeting’s agenda, at the Chair's
discretion. Comments will normally be limited to three
minutes.
